David Rogers Webb's "The Great Taking" blends elements of personal narrative with a conspiracy theory centered on global elites.
The book presents a critical perspective on economic systems and power structures.
Webb's background in the hedge fund industry adds a layer of intrigue to his analysis.
The work is characterized by its unconventional approach and controversial claims.
While it may appeal to readers interested in alternative viewpoints, its lack of rigorous evidence and reliance on speculation limit its credibility.
